Part-Time Bookkeeper & Property Administrator
Part-Time Bookkeeper & Property Administrator
Role:
Part-Time – Senior Bookkeeper & Property Administrator
Contract Type:
Permanent, Part-Time
Location:
Outskirts of Tunbridge Wells
Salary: £30-£34 per hour
Hours:
16-24 hours per week (2-3 days)
Our client, a well-established company based on the outskirts of Tunbridge Wells, is looking to recruit an experienced Senior Bookkeeper & Property Administrator to support the financial management of several small businesses, residential properties and private household accounts.
This is a varied position offering the opportunity to take ownership of day-to-day bookkeeping while supporting the administration of a diverse property portfolio. The successful candidate will play a key role in ensuring the smooth running of the company’s financial and administrative operations.
Key Duties:- Maintaining accurate financial records across multiple limited companies, residential properties and household accounts using Quick Books.
- Processing purchase invoices, supplier payments and bank reconciliations through online banking.
- Managing payroll for employees, including pensions, HMRC submissions, expenses, payslips and year-end documentation.
- Preparing VAT returns, financial reports, trial balances and supporting documentation for external accountants and auditors.
- Producing cash flow forecasts and monitoring company and personal account balances.
- Raising sales invoices and monitoring outstanding payments.
- Managing bookkeeping for holiday-let and rental properties, including income and expenditure records.
- Liaising with tenants, contractors, suppliers and service providers regarding property maintenance and repairs.
- Coordinating servicing schedules, insurance renewals, maintenance contracts and compliance across multiple residential properties.
- Maintaining Companies House records, employee records and organised electronic and paper filing systems.
- Providing general office administration, including correspondence, document preparation and telephone and email enquiries.
- A minimum of five years' bookkeeping experience within a similar standalone or small business environment.
- Strong working knowledge of Quick Books and Excel.
- Experience managing payroll, business taxes, VAT returns, bank reconciliations and preparing accounts for external accountants.
- A sound understanding of UK bookkeeping principles and financial record keeping.
- Excellent organ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ities and work independently.
- High levels of accuracy, discretion and confidentiality.
- Strong communication skills with the confidence to liaise professionally with contractors, suppliers, tenants and external advisers.
- Previous experience supporting residential property administration would be advantageous but is not essential.
